Install Android on VirtualBox or Vmware

Aug 16, 2011
iasava

หลังจากที่ได้เขียนบทความเรื่อง ทดลองใช้ Android บน PC ด้วย Android SDK วันนี้ก็มีอีกหนึ่งบทความเกี่ยวกับการจำลอง Android สำหรับคนที่อยากลองเล่นๆ หรือพัฒนา App บน Android OS เราจะมาติดตั้งบน VirtualBox ซึ่งก็จะคล้ายๆกับติดตั้งบน Vmware แต่ต่างกันตรงที่ Vmware นั้นไม่ฟรีครับ ผมได้ทอลองติดตั้งบน Ubuntu 11.04 นะครับ ไปดูขั้นตอนกันเลย


ก่อนอื่นเลยก็ต้องไปดาวน์โหลดไฟล์อิมเมจของ Android ที่นี่เลยครับ android-x86.org จะมีเวอร์ชั่นต่างๆ ผมใช้ “android-x86-2.2-eeepc.iso” จากนั้นก็เปิดโปรแกรม VirtualBox มาเลยครับ จากนั้นคลิกที่ New เพื่อสร้าง Virtual Machine ครับ

คลิก Next เลย

ตั้งชื่อ Virtual Machine, Operating System = Other, Version = Other/Unknow แล้ว Next เลย

ต่อไปก็กำหนดขนาดของ Memory ครับ

ต่อไปก็สร้าง Virtual Harddisk

ไม่มีไร Next เลยครับ

ต่อไปก็เป็นการกำหนดขนาดมีให้เลือก 2 แบบ Dynamically กับ Fixed-size แนะนำว่าเลือก Dynamically จะดีกว่าครับเพราะว่าพื้นที่ที่จะใช้งานจะเท่ากับขนาดไฟล์ Virtual ที่เราสร้าง แต่ Fixed จะเป็นการจองพื้นที่ไปเลย

แล้วมากำหนดขนาดพื้นที่ Harddisk สูงสุด เอาแค่ 2 GB ก็พอครับ

สรุปการติดตั้งทั้งหมด คลิก Finish เลยครับ

มาที่ Setting ครับ เพื่อเลือกไฟล์อิมเมจที่เราดาวน์โหลดมา

เลือก Storage

เลือก Empty แล้วคลิกที่รูป CD ขวาสุดเพื่อ Browse หาไฟล์อิมเมจ

เมื่อเสร็จแล้วก็จะได้ดังรูป

แล้วก็ Start Virtual Machine เลยครับ

เมื่อ Boot ขึ้นมาเราก็จะเจอเมนูต่างๆ ถ้าไม่อยากติดตั้งก็เลือก Live CD ครับ ส่วนบทความนี้เรามาเลือก Install บน Harddisk ครับ เมนูอันสุดท้ายเลย

จากนั้นจะเป็นการสร้าง Partitions ครับ เลือก Create/Modify Partition ครับ

เลือก New ครับ

เลือก Primary

กำหนดขนาดของ Partition ครับเอาหมดเลย 2 GB

เราจะได้ Sda1 จากนั้นเลือกให้เป็น Bootable

เลือก Write เพื่อส้ราง Partition

จะมีการ Confirm อีกครั้งให้พิมพ์ yes ครับ

ก็จะได้ Sda1 ดังรูป แล้วเลือก OK ครับ

ทำการ format เลือกเป็นแบบ ext3

ยืนยันการ Format

ติดตั้ง boot loader ด้วยครับเลือก yes

อันนี้เลือก no ครับ

ติดตั้งเสร็จแล้วเลือก Run Android-x86

เข้าสู้หน้าจอ Android ครับ รอสักครู่

ลองเปิดเว็บดู

จบแล้วครับ ลองไปทำกันดูนะครับ ชอบก็ Like ให้ด้วยนะครับ

Related posts: